Powering the Future with Silicon Carbide Motor Controllers

The rapid emergence of silicon carbide as the preferred material for motor controller semiconductors marks a significant turning point in the evolution of power electronics. With superior thermal conductivity, higher switching frequencies, and enhanced efficiency over traditional silicon-based counterparts, silicon carbide motor controllers are redefining the benchmarks for performance and reliability. This technological leap is driven by the converging demands of electrification, decarbonization, and the pursuit of operational excellence across a range of industries.

Adoption of these advanced controllers is accelerating in high-growth sectors where compact design, energy savings, and robust performance under extreme conditions are paramount. Electric vehicles demand seamless torque control and extended range, renewable energy systems require efficient power conversion at scale, and industrial drives benefit from minimized energy losses and reduced cooling requirements. Each application scenario underscores the transformative potential of silicon carbide to deliver next-generation capabilities that drive productivity, sustainability, and cost efficiencies.

Despite clear advantages, widespread deployment of these controllers faces challenges related to material costs, manufacturing complexity, and supply chain stability. To navigate this landscape, stakeholders must weigh the technical benefits against economic considerations, while monitoring policy developments and tariff structures. Tariff Turbulence Shaping the US Market in 2025

In 2025, new tariff measures imposed by the United States are exerting significant pressure on the silicon carbide motor controller supply chain, altering competitive dynamics and cost structures. Import duties on raw wafers, discrete modules, and integrated power assemblies have driven landed costs upward, necessitating strategic adjustments by manufacturers and system integrators. These changes are intensifying the focus on domestic production capabilities and incentivizing regional alliances aimed at mitigating exposure to import taxes.

This tariff environment has ripple effects across the value chain. Component distributors are recalibrating inventory strategies to shield customers from pricing volatility, while end-users are reassessing total cost of ownership by factoring in duty-driven margins. Some producers are exploring backward integration into wafer production and power module assembly, seeking to internalize key processes and secure preferential supply terms. Others are reevaluating global manufacturing footprints to optimize logistics and duty pathways.

At the same time, bilateral trade negotiations and potential tariff exemptions for critical energy infrastructure components offer windows of opportunity. Companies adept at navigating these policy nuances can leverage temporary relief measures to accelerate deployment projects. Looking ahead, a proactive approach to tariff risk management will be essential for sustaining growth, preserving profit margins, and maintaining competitiveness in a market increasingly shaped by regulatory dynamics.

Deconstructing Market Segments for Strategic Clarity

A nuanced understanding of market segments is essential for pinpointing growth pockets and aligning product development with end-user requirements. When examining the landscape through the lens of power rating, the market spans controllers optimized for under 100 kW applications, mid-range systems between 100 kW and 500 kW, and heavy-duty units exceeding 500 kW, each segment addressing distinct performance and efficiency thresholds. Layering in module type reveals a divergence between discrete semiconductor assemblies and integrated power modules, the latter offering compact form factors and simplified thermal management for space-constrained installations.

Phase configuration further differentiates solutions, as single-phase controllers cater to residential and light commercial appliances, while three-phase architectures dominate in industrial drive applications and electric vehicle propulsion systems. Device type segmentation highlights the critical roles of JFET-based switches, MOSFET solutions, and Schottky diode rectifiers, with each topology balancing trade-offs between switching speed, conduction losses, and cost. Application-driven demand flows from consumer appliances seeking energy compliance, electric vehicles requiring peak power density, industrial drives focused on process assurance, and renewable energy systems demanding high reliability under cyclical loads.

Finally, evaluating end use industry sheds light on distinct requirements shaping adoption patterns. Aerospace and defense prioritize ruggedization and stringent qualification standards, automotive mandates drive integration with onboard diagnostics and safety protocols, and industrial sectors encompassing manufacturing and processing emphasize uptime and modular servicing. Renewable energy deployments introduce long-duration performance expectations and grid-support functionalities. Taken together, these segmentation insights offer a strategic roadmap for tailoring product portfolios and investment priorities to address evolving market needs.

Regional Dynamics Driving Global Adoption

Regional dynamics play a pivotal role in shaping adoption trajectories and investment priorities for silicon carbide motor controllers. In the Americas, strong policy support for clean transportation and grid modernization is fueling demand across electric vehicle charging infrastructure and distributed renewable generation. Domestic semiconductor initiatives and tax credits for advanced manufacturing are further strengthening the case for local production and end-to-end supply chain integration.

Across Europe, the Middle East & Africa, ambitious decarbonization targets and regulatory mandates on energy efficiency are accelerating the transition to wide bandgap power electronics. Collaborative research consortia and incentive schemes are channeling funds into pilot projects for smart grids and industrial automation, while geopolitical considerations are prompting diversification of component sources to ensure resilience.

The Asia-Pacific region remains the largest growth engine, underpinned by rapid electrification of public transportation, expansion of renewable capacity, and burgeoning industrial digitization. Government subsidies for electric buses, solar inverters, and manufacturing modernization are translating into sizable procurement pipelines. Regional foundries and power module assemblers are scaling up production to meet both local and export demands, fostering a robust ecosystem that spans raw material suppliers through system integrators.
